The first step in DNA replication is to separate or unzip the two strands of the double helix. The enzyme in charge of this is called a helicase (because it unwinds the helix). The point where the double helix is opened up and the DNA is copied is called a replication fork. What is it called when DNA is unzipped?

What’s more, in DNA, uracil is replaced with the base thymine, or T, which has a … WebDNA is unzipped during its replication process; the two strands of the double helix are separated and a new complementary DNA strand is synthesized from the parent strands. Also, during DNA transcription, one DNA strand, known as the template strand, is transcribed (copied) into an RNA strand.
Web17. Transcription: from DNA to mRNA. Both prokaryotes and eukaryotes perform fundamentally the same process of transcription, with the important difference of the membrane-bound nucleus in eukaryotes. With the genes bound in the nucleus, transcription occurs in the nucleus of the cell and the mRNA transcript must be transported to the …

Each gene (or group of co-transcribed genes, in bacteria) has its own … i missed a dose of keppraWebDNA replication is semi-conservative. This means that each of the two strands in double-stranded DNA acts as a template to produce two new strands.
